Causes Of Ptosis (Drooping Eyelid)

Ptosis occurs when levators, the muscles that raise the eyelid are not strong enough to do so properly. Ptosis can also be a result of trauma/damage to the levator, or damage to the oculomotor nerve which is responsible for controlling the levator. Acquaint with Ptosis

A ptosis refers to the drooping of the upper eyelid, that may cover a part or the entire pupil thus interfering with the vision. The drooping may be worse when the muscles are tired.
